Coxinha de Frango

Coxinha de Frango is a beloved Brazilian snack featuring tender chicken wrapped in a savory dough, shaped like a drumstick, and fried to golden perfection. This protein-packed dish is perfect for a satisfying lunch or a delicious appetizer.

Ingredients

  • Chicken breast - 250 grams
  • Onion - 1 medium, finely chopped
  • Garlic - 2 cloves, minced
  • Cream cheese - 50 grams
  • Chicken broth - 250 ml
  • Flour - 150 grams
  • Butter - 30 grams
  • Egg - 1 large, beaten
  • Breadcrumbs - 100 grams
  • Salt - 1 teaspoon
  • Black pepper -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Olive oil - for frying

Steps

  1. In a pot, cook the chicken breast in boiling water until fully cooked, about 15-20 minutes. Remove the chicken, shred it, and set aside.
  2. In a skillet, heat a t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, sauté until translucent.
  3. Add the shredded chicken to the skillet, along with cream cheese, salt, and black pepper. Mix well, and cook for 5 minutes. Set the filling aside to cool.
  4. In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the flour and stir continuously for about 2 minutes until golden.
  5. Gradually add the chicken broth, stirring constantly until a smooth dough forms. Remove from heat and let it cool slightly.
  6. Once the dough is cool enough to handle, take a small portion, flatten it in your hand, and place a spoonful of the chicken filling in the center. Shape the dough around the filling into a teardrop shape.
  7. Repeat the process until all the dough and filling are used.
  8. Dip each coxinha into the beaten egg, then coat with breadcrumbs.
  9. In a deep pan, heat olive oil for frying. Fry the coxinhas in batches until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es per side. Drain on paper towels.
  10. Serve warm with your favorite dipping sauce.
